Component: BC-FES-GRA
Component Name: Graphic
Description: The usage, appearance and structure of a graphical object.
Key Concepts: Form definition is a component of the SAP BC-FES-GRA Graphic User Interface. It is used to define the layout of a form, including the size, position, and content of each element. It also defines the behavior of the form, such as how it responds to user input. How to use it: Form definition is used to create forms that can be used in SAP applications. To create a form, you must first define the layout of the form, including the size, position, and content of each element. You can then define the behavior of the form, such as how it responds to user input. Once you have defined the form, you can save it and use it in your application.
